How do AI agents ensure patient data privacy and HIPAA compliance?
AI agents deployed in healthcare must adhere strictly to HIPAA regulations. Reputable AI solutions are built with robust security protocols, including data encryption, access controls, and audit trails. They are designed to process Protected Health Information (PHI) in a compliant manner, often through secure, HIPAA-compliant cloud environments or on-premise integrations. Vendors typically provide Business Associate Agreements (BAAs) to ensure their services meet all necessary privacy and security standards. Continuous monitoring and regular security audits are standard practice within the industry for AI in healthcare.
What is the typical timeline for deploying AI agents in a medical practice?
The deployment timeline for AI agents varies based on the complexity of the use case and the existing IT infrastructure. For administrative tasks like patient scheduling or intake, initial pilots can often be implemented within 4-8 weeks. More complex integrations, such as those involving deep EHR integration for clinical documentation or advanced revenue cycle management, may take 3-6 months. This timeframe includes configuration, testing, and user training, aligning with industry standards for healthcare IT implementations.

What data and integration requirements are needed for AI agents?
AI agents require access to relevant data to function effectively. For administrative agents, this might include scheduling systems, patient demographic databases, and communication logs. For clinical or billing agents, integration with the Electronic Health Record (EHR) system is often necessary. Data must be in a structured or semi-structured format, and secure APIs are typically used for integration. Most modern EHR systems support standardized integration methods, and AI vendors often have pre-built connectors for common platforms used in the hospital and health care industry.
